Background/Discussion
The City is required to certify its maximum City levy and the HRA and EDA levies to the County
Auditor no later than September 15: The levy adopted in September may be reduced on December 6
when the final levy is adopted, but it may not be increased. The levy adopted in September will be used
in the tax notices mailed to property owners in November. The Council must also schedule one regular
meeting at which the budget and levy will be discussed and public comment will be taken. This meeting
date, scheduled for December 6, 2010, must also be set by September 15.
The remainder of the General fund and special revenue fund budgets that the Council has not yet
reviewed are attached. Those include the building safety, environmental, and energy city General fund
budgets, and the Storm Water Management, Safety, and Library special revenue fund budgets. Staff will
be present at the meeting to discuss these budgets with the Council. There are no significant changes in
these budgets for 2011.
Also attached is a sample levy resolution fox discussion. We have not received updated net tax capacity
data from Sherburne County, but expect to get that data before the levy is adopted on September 13.
The sample levy calls for a total levy identical to the 2010 payable levy. Consequently, the General fund
budget as proposed assumes tax revenue based on that total levy. Again, it is important to note that the
levy adopted now cannot be increased in December. If the revised NTC estimate from the County is
higher than the preliminary estimate, a revised levy resolution will be prepared for the September 13
meeting.
If the levy is approved as discussed above, there is currently a General fund budget gap of $514,100
before use of fund balance and without including LGA revenue of $686,800. As you may recall, the

budget gap was $551,700. That was reduced by some minor adjustments as discussed by the Council and
other adjustments and corrections made by staff. Please refer to the attached spreadsheet fox those
details. In addition, there may be adjustments following this work session that will be included in the
final budget. Also, the draft budget includes $320,400 of capital outlay. Per our previous discussions,
some of those requests may not be approved. If $325,000 of fund balance is used as it was in 2010, the
budget gap is less than $190,000. That can be addressed by delaying some capital outlay until LGA funds
are received.
There are two other budget related items discussed at the work sessions that require follow-up before
adoption of the final budget: First, staff would like authorization to move forward now with replacing
the ice arena vessels for $16,500 since that is an insurance requirement. Funds are available in the Capital
Outlay Reserve set aside by the City and designated for the ice arena to cover this expenditure. Second,
the Fire Chief and I discussed the duty officer program with the Council at the August 9 meeting. If the
Council agrees with proceeding with this program, the Fire Chief would like to begin an early
implementation of the program in 2010. Funds are available from the part-time pay line item in the fire
department budget to cover the 2010 expense. An additional $23,500 will be added to the 2011 budget if
the Council approves the duty officer program.
Finally, the detail budget information was distributed to the Council for the August meetings and is not
included with this memo. If you want another copy of any of the previously distributed material, please
contact me. Staff will be prepared to go over the levy and budget at the work session in as much detail as
the Council desires. The Council may adopt the levy resolutions and set the budget meeting date at this
worksession or at the September 13 worksession.

RESOLUTION 10-
A RESOLUTION FOR THE CITY OF ELK RIVER
A RESOLUTION APPROVING THE HOUSING AND REDEVELOPMENT
AUTHORITY 201 I TAX LEVY
WHEREAS, the Housing and Redevelopment Authority in and for the City of Elk Rivex
has requested that the City authorize a levy of .0144% of the taxable market
value of the City for various redevelopment activities; and,
WHEREAS, the City Council of the City of Elk River has consented to this levy.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the City Council of the City of Elk River
that the Housing and Redevelopment Authority in and for the City of Elk River certify a
levy of .0144% of the taxable market in the City for the benefit of the Housing and
Redevelopment Authority.
Passed and adopted by the City Council of the City of Elk River, Minnesota this 7`'' day of
September 2010.

RESOLUTION 10-
A RESOLUTION FOR THE CITY OF ELK RIVER
A RESOLUTION APPROVING THE 201 I TAX LEVY FOR ECONOMIC
DEVELOPMENT PURPOSES FOR THE ELK RIVER ECONOMIC
DEVELOPMENT AUTHORITY
WHEREAS, the City Council of the City of Elk River has received a request from the
Economic Development Authority to levy a tax for the benefit of the
Authority in the amount of .01813% of taxable market value of taxable
property in the City for the year of 2011.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the City Council of the City of Elk River
as follows: The City Council of the City of Elk River proposes that a tax in the amount of
.01813% of the taxable market value in the City be levied in the year 2011 for the benefit of
the City of Elk River Economic Development Authority to be used for Economic
Development Authority purposes as provided under Minnesota Statute 469.090 et.se .
Passed and adopted by the City Council of the City of Elk River, Minnesota this 7`'' day of
September 2010.
